CPSIL currently houses four Thermo Electron gas isotope-ratio mass spectrometers
and nine preparation devices.
1. The DELTA V Advantage is configured through the CONFLO III for automated
continuous-flow analysis of C, N, or S isotopes in solid
inorganic/organic samples using our Carlo Erba NC2100 Elemental Analyzer (EA) or our Costech
ECS4010 Elemental Analyzer. The V is also interfaced to a Gas Bench II for automated
analyses of C and O in carbonates .
2. The DELTA plus Advantage is configured through the CONFLO III for automated
continuous-flow analysis of C, N, or S isotopes in solid
inorganic/organic samples using our Carlo Erba NC2100 Elemental Analyzer (EA) or our Costech
ECS4010 Elemental Analyzer.
3. The DELTA plus XL is configured through the CONFLO II for automated continuous-flow
analysis of O and H isotopes in solid inorganic/organic
samples via high-temperature
pyrolysis (TC/EA). The XL is also interfaced to our second Gas Bench II for automated
analyses of O and H isotopes in water, and our
O.I. Analytical TOC analyzer for measurement of C isotopes in water (DIC
and DOC). The XL has a classic dual-inlet interface for sample and reference injection through pressurized bellows..
4. The DELTA plus is configured for continuous-flow
analysis of N, O, and C isotopes in trace gases (N2O, CH4, and CO2) at atmospheric
concentrations using a Thermo Finnigan Precon. The Plus is also interfaced
with our new Trace GC-C system for C isotopes in compound-specific analyses.
In summary, we can determine C, N, S, O, and H isotope compositions of gases
(either purified or in mixtures at atmospheric concentrations), organics
(solid and liquid, of plant and animal origin), inorganics, waters, and at compound-specific levels..
